Cross-Site Request Forgery Vulnerability in Jenkins Reverse Proxy Auth Plugin by Jenkins
CVE-2023-32987

Summary
The Jenkins Reverse Proxy Auth Plugin version 1.7.4 and earlier is susceptible to a cross-site request forgery (CSRF) vulnerability. This flaw allows attackers to send requests that can connect to an attacker-specified LDAP server by using attacker-provided credentials. Such exploitation can lead to unauthorized access and control over user accounts, making it critical for users of the plugin to ensure their systems are updated and configured properly.
Affected Version(s)
Jenkins Reverse Proxy Auth Plugin 0 <= 1.7.4
